Working with Children Check
The Working with Children (WWC) Check helps to protect children from sexual or physical harm by checking a person's criminal history for serious sexual, serious violence or serious drug offences and the persons history with specific professional disciplinary bodies for certain findings.
The introduction of the WWC Check creates a mandatory minimum checking standard across Victoria for adults to engage in child-related work as defined in the Working with Children Act 2005.
The WWC Check is an initiative of the Victorian Government and is administered by the Department of Justice.
